Reduction of Na+ (E° = –2.7 v) is energetically more difficult than the reduction of water (–1.23 v), so in aqueous solution, the latter will prevail. If sodium chloride is melted (above 801 °C), two electrodes are inserted into the melt, and an electric current is passed through the molten salt, then chemical reactions take place at the electrodes. This means that when one mole of salt (NaCl) is dissolved in water, the resulting solution does not contain any molecules of NaCl, it contains the ions Na + and Cl -: With ionic compounds, chemists often talk about ionic concentrations, or the concentrations of the individual ions. Since water can be both oxidized and reduced, it competes with the dissolved Na+ and Cl– ions. This results in chemical reactions at the electrodes and the separation of materials. The full ionic equation for the neutralization of hydrochloric acid by sodium hydroxide is written as follows: Since the acid and base are both strong, they are fully ionized and so are written as ions, as is the NaCl formed as a product. Similarly, NaOH and NaCl are soluble ionic compounds, and are correctly represented as Na + (aq) + OH − (aq), and Na + (aq) + Cl − (aq) respectively. The net ionic equation shows only the chemical species that are involved in a reaction, while the complete ionic equation also includes spectator ions. The net ionic equation is commonly used in acid-base neutralization reactions, double displacement reactions, and redox reactions. Lastly, the water will remain as an unionized neutral molecule, since it is a stable, nonelectrolyte species. The corresponding ionic equation is: (16.18.2) Na + (a q) + Cl − (a q) + Ag + (a q) + NO 3 − (a q) → Na + (a q) + NO 3 − (a q) + AgCl (s) If you look carefully at the ionic equation, you will notice that the sodium ion and the nitrate ion appear unchanged on both sides of the equation.
